Where do you end and everything else begins?
Sometimes we don’t realise our boundaries have been crossed until we feel overwhelmed, drained, or off balance. Life can blur the edges—whether it’s pressure to say “yes,” people-pleasing, or the quiet habit of putting others first.
This course is a space to gently explore your own limits. To notice where you feel stretched, and where you need room to breathe. You’ll learn how healthy boundaries can support your wellbeing—and how to honour them with clarity, care, and confidence.
